What is Gonorrhea and Why Should You Care?
Gonorrhea, often referred to as "the clap," is a bacterial infection caused by the Neisseria gonorrhoeae bacterium. It's pretty common, with the World Health Organization (WHO) estimating around 87 million new cases each year. Here's why you should care:
- Symptoms: Gonorrhea can cause uncomfortable symptoms like pain during urination, abnormal discharge, and in severe cases, infertility. - Complications: Untreated gonorrhea can lead to serious health issues, like Pelvic Inflammatory Disease (PID) in women, and even increase the risk of HIV transmission. - Antibiotic Resistance: Some strains of gonorrhea are becoming resistant to common antibiotics, making treatment more challenging.
The Evolution of Gonorrhea: Strains and Mutations
Like all living things, strains of gonorrhea evolve and change over time. These changes can happen due to various factors, including exposure to antibiotics and the human immune system. Let's explore some of the most talked-about strains:
Multi-drug Resistant Gonorrhea (MDRG)
One of the most concerning strains of gonorrhea is the multi-drug resistant type, often referred to as MDRG. This strain is resistant to common antibiotics like penicillin and some strains of cephalosporins, making treatment difficult. The World Health Organization has even identified MDRG as one of the three most worrying antibiotic-resistant pathogens.
H041 and H041-like Strains
The H041 strain, first identified in Japan, is another cause for concern. It's resistant to many antibiotics, including extended-spectrum cephalosporins, which are often used as a last resort. The H041-like strains are genetically similar to H041 and also show high levels of resistance.
FC428 and FC428-like Strains
The FC428 strain, first identified in France, is also resistant to many antibiotics. It's part of the FC428-like strains group, which includes strains with similar genetic characteristics and high levels of antibiotic resistance.
How Do Different Strains Affect Treatment?
The strain of gonorrhea can significantly impact your treatment options. For example:
- MDRG: Due to its resistance to common antibiotics, treating MDRG requires a combination of drugs, often with less effective or more expensive options. - H041 and H041-like Strains: These strains may also require combination therapy, and treatment may need to be guided by antibiotic susceptibility testing. - FC428 and FC428-like Strains: Similar to H041 and H041-like strains, these may require combination therapy and susceptibility testing.
Preventing Gonorrhea and the Spread of Resistant Strains
While we can't control the evolution of strains of gonorrhea, we can take steps to prevent infection and slow the spread of resistant strains:
- Safe Sex: Use condoms consistently and correctly to reduce the risk of STIs, including gonorrhea. - Regular STI Testing: Regular testing can help catch infections early, preventing complications and reducing the spread of resistant strains. - Antibiotic Stewardship: Only use antibiotics when necessary and as prescribed by a healthcare professional. This helps reduce the development of resistant strains.
The Future of Gonorrhea Treatment
Research is ongoing to find new ways to treat gonorrhea, especially resistant strains. Some promising avenues include:
- New Antibiotics: Scientists are working on developing new antibiotics specifically designed to target resistant strains. - Vaccines: A gonorrhea vaccine could prevent infection and slow the spread of resistant strains. However, creating an effective vaccine has proven challenging. - Combination Therapies: Using a combination of drugs can help overcome antibiotic resistance. Researchers are exploring new combinations and delivery methods.
